I would really like to start seeing some lower numbers, what am I doing wrong? Could the food thing be a culprit here? I don't see any way around it, he grazes. period. I have tried meal-feeding and they wouldn't eat. So in the morning we test, feed and shoot and at the first sitting he probably eats 1/4th of a can(3.3oz)if that. Then he comes back every hour or so and eats a littel more. He eats a whole can but over the course of a whole day. On days I don't have a night class I can pull the food around 5-6 but when I have class, 2 nights a week I get home right at test time. We test/shoot at 8:30 am/pm. Any ideas? Should I stick with the 1.5 and wait until I see my vet on the 17th for Java's dental? I really am trying to be patient. I know this doesn't happen overnight but I just hate seeing so much pink.
